Round 1 Difference between equals() and == in java? Questions on java streams. How to design springboot application - explain layered architecture Eager and Lazy loading question in springboot and react Pagination and sorting JPA repo related questions Round 2 Coding question - Insert, delete, get random, minimum element within constant time. Use List (linked list implementation) and Map. System design question - design a live dashboard which shows data coming in key value pairs metrics from cell towers and detect and notify incase of any anomalies. Also get recent data based on timelines - Use Cassandra DB for key value pairs data storage, async processing for anomalies detection, apache spark DB for retrieving data based on timestamps.
Lead Backend Developer Interview Questions
12,387 lead backend developer interview questions shared by candidates
How does the garbage collector work in Java?
Past projects you have worked on
Generic question like overall experience and domain knowledge ( which I had). Tech round involved some deep dive on the system design topic like performance, including some not so difficult coding challenge. In the 'Meet the team' round they asked me some more technical questions but it was mostly informal.
What should have been asked but never did - how good is your "business acumen"?
Describe the internal implementation of a hash map
How would you make a slow query faster?
explain your previous working experience
Second interview: A technical assessment where I had to refactor an existing codebase consisting of two APIs that depended on each other.
Modelize a real-life problem with the language of my choice.
Viewing 8651 - 8660 interview questions